Hearst Television Inc., parent company of New Orleans NBC affiliate WDSU-Channel 6 and 28 other stations around the country, is warning viewers that the station's signal could go dark for DirecTV
subscribers on Jan. 1.
"Satellite distributors are prohibited by law from carrying broadcasters' signals without their consent," the Hearst e-mail stated. "The removal of WDSU-TV from
the DirecTV system will only result if negotiations between representatives of Hearst Television Inc., WDSU's parent company, and DirecTV are unsuccessful in reaching a conclusion before December
31st, 2010." The e-mail and later post, which mirrors notices posted on websites at several Hearst outlets around the country - including Baltimore, Oklahoma City and Omaha, among others.
